当前位置: 首页 > news >正文

C 语言测验

C 语言测验

引言

C 语言作为一种历史悠久且广泛使用的编程语言,自1972年由Dennis Ritchie在贝尔实验室发明以来,一直是计算机科学领域的基石。C 语言以其高效、灵活、可移植的特点,在操作系统、嵌入式系统、游戏开发等多个领域占据着重要地位。为了帮助读者深入了解C语言,本文将围绕C语言测验这一主题,从基础知识、高级特性、实际应用等方面进行详细介绍。

C语言基础知识

1. C语言发展历程

C语言诞生于20世纪70年代初,经过多年的发展,已经成为一种非常成熟的语言。以下是C语言的发展历程:

  • 1972年:C语言由Dennis Ritchie在贝尔实验室发明。
  • 1973年:C语言在UNIX操作系统中得到应用。
  • 1983年:ANSI C标准(ISO C)发布。
  • 1989年:C89标准(也称为ANSI C)发布。
  • 1990年:C90标准(也称为ISO C90)发布。
  • 1999年:C99标准发布,增加了新的语言特性。

2. C语言特点

C语言具有以下特点:

  • 高效:C语言编译后的代码运行速度快,占用资源少。
  • 灵活:C语言支持多种数据类型和运算符,便于编程人员实现复杂的算法。
  • 可移植:C语言具

相关文章:

  • 《Linux运维总结:基于银河麒麟V10+ARM64架构CPU二进制部署单实例rabbitmq3.10.25》
  • windows使用nvm管理node版本
  • 3. 费曼学习法?
  • 性能比拼: Pingora vs Nginx (My NEW Favorite Proxy)
  • 蓝桥杯 刷题对应的题解
  • stm32 can 遥控帧的问题
  • 全局曝光与卷帘曝光
  • 海康摄像头通过Web插件进行预览播放和控制
  • IP 地址规划中的子网划分:/18 网络容纳 64 个 C 段(/24)的原理与应用解析
  • SpringCould微服务架构之Docker(8)
  • 面基:Java项目中跟钉钉接口对接,如何确保数据传输安全性和稳定性
  • 深度学习 Deep Learning 第11章 实用方法论
  • 25-智慧旅游系统(协同算法)三端
  • Redis:内存淘汰原则,缓存击穿,缓存穿透,缓存雪崩
  • 从零开始:如何打造一套完整的UI设计系统?
  • 数据可视化——让数据说话的魔法
  • java反射笔记、内省、动态代理
  • Redis 梳理汇总目录
  • torch.nn.Conv2d介绍——Pytorch中的二维卷积层
  • 非对称加密算法详解
  • 庆祝上海总工会成立100周年暨市模范集体劳动模范和先进工作者表彰大会举行,陈吉宁寄予这些期待
  • 拿出压箱底作品,北京交响乐团让上海观众享受音乐盛宴
  • 夜读丨喜马拉雅山的背夫
  • 上海优化营商环境再攻坚,企业和机构有哪些切实感受?
  • 调节负面情绪可以缓解慢性疼痛
  • 印方称若巴方决定升级局势,印方已做好反击准备